1. The Irish Licensing System at a Glance
The Road Safety Authority (RSA) governs chauffeur testing and roadway safety in Ireland, while the National Driver Licence Service (NDLS) deals with applications, renewals, and exchanges.
Ireland runs a tiered licensing system. For guest cars and trucks (Category B), the journey typically moves from a Learner Permit to a Full Driving Licence.
